What is a Bedside Cot?
A bedside Cot Bed With Storage, also referred to as a co-sleeper or side sleeper, is a kind of crib that is designed to connect firmly to the side of the moms and dad's bed. It enables easy access to the baby throughout the night while supplying a separate sleeping space. This design supports safe sleep practices while facilitating nighttime feeding and reassuring.

Promotes Safe Sleep
Bedside cots comply with safe sleep guidelines as the infant has its own sleeping space. This separation reduces the risk of suffocation and getting too hot, which prevail interest in conventional co-sleeping arrangements.
2. Boosts Bonding
Having a bedside cot allows parents to react quickly to their baby's requirements throughout the night. This distance can strengthen the parent-child bond and motivate a psychological connection.
3. Assists In Nighttime Feeding
For breastfeeding moms, bedside cots provide the perfect solution for nighttime feedings without the requirement to fully awaken or rise.
4. Lowers Stress
The close range permits parents to feel more at ease, knowing they can examine their baby without getting out of bed. This plan can result in a more restful sleep for both the parent and the child.
5. Versatile Use
Lots of bedside cots can change into standalone cribs, making them a long-lasting financial investment in your child's sleeping arrangements. They can frequently be used till the child is around 6-12 months old, depending on the particular model.
Factors to consider When Choosing a Bedside Cot
When acquiring a bedside Cot Beds With Storage, it is important to consider different aspects:
1. Security Standards
Make sure that the cot complies with regional safety regulations. Look for brands that have actually been checked and certified for safety.
2. Bed mattress Quality
The quality of the bed mattress is important for the health and convenience of the baby. A firm, supportive mattress is required to avoid issues such as SIDS (Sudden Infant Death Syndrome).
3. Budget plan
Bedside cots are available in a variety of costs. Set a budget and consider the very best worth for the features you need.
4. Size and Space
Make sure to examine the measurements of the cot and ensure that it fits well beside your bed. If space is a concern, go with a design that is easily portable or collapsible.
5. Ease of Assembly
Some cots are more complicated to assemble than others. Try to find models that are easy to use, especially if you expect moving the cot more than when.

Are bedside cots safe for newborns?
Yes, bedside cots are created to provide a safe sleeping environment for newborns, provided they fulfill safety standards and are established correctly.
2. At what age can my baby shift from a bedside cot?
Normally, babies can use bedside cots up until they are about 6-12 months old or until they can pull themselves up or roll over. Always describe the producer's guidelines.
3. Can bedside cots be used for taking a trip?
Many bedside cots are portable and foldable, making them suitable for travel. However, ensure that the specific design you select is created for easy transportation.
4. How do I ensure the bedside cot is safe and secure to my bed?
Follow the manufacturer's instructions thoroughly for attaching the Cot With Drawer Underneath to your bed. Most designs have mechanisms to protect them tightly.
5. Can I use a routine crib instead of a bedside cot?
While a regular crib uses a safe sleeping space, it does not supply the same convenience for nighttime access and bonding that bedside cots do.
